Questions people ask

Is Hollystown a good place to live?

Addris scores Hollystown 80 out of 100 for a home buyer (Strong) and 76 for an investor. The score weighs transport, everyday convenience, schools and family services, flood and other risk, market strength and planning activity for the area — the sections below show each part.

What is the average house price in Hollystown?

The median sold price in Hollystown, County Dublin over the last 12 months was €449,339, from 60 sales in the Property Price Register (data to 2026-09-13). Over five years the median is €420,000 from 457 sales.

How many homes sold in Hollystown in the last year?

60 residential sales in Hollystown, County Dublin were recorded in the Property Price Register in the last 12 months, and 457 in the last five years.

What is public transport like in Hollystown?

Hollystown, County Dublin has 8 bus, rail and Luas stops with about 3,320 scheduled departures a week, from the National Transport Authority's timetable data.

What schools are in Hollystown?

There are 2 primary and 0 secondary schools inside the Hollystown area on the Department of Education register, and 5 registered childcare services.

Is there much building planned in Hollystown?

17 planning applications were submitted in Hollystown, County Dublin in the last 12 months; of the 17 decided in that time, 12 were granted.

Where does this data come from?

Sold prices are the Residential Property Price Register published by the Property Services Regulatory Authority; planning applications come from the National Planning Application Database (Tailte Éireann) and council feeds; transport from the National Transport Authority; schools, childcare and health services from their public registers.
